Physics class? For kindergar teners? Isn’t that a bit advanced? Yet physics is everywhere in our daily lives and children’s early questions are about physics, including: “Could I play on a seesaw with an elephant?” “Why does a shadow follow the sun?” “How can monorail trains hover above a track?
……
Starting with children’s most common life experiences, this series answers young readers’ questions from a child’s perspective via small experiments and clever flaps, slides, and pop-ups. Not only will young readers understand what lies behind daily phenomena, but they will also discover the magic of science and that seemingly advanced subjects such as physics, geography, biology, etc., are actually not difficult at all, thus planting the seeds for future, deeper knowledge and a fascination for science!
